The Eucalyptus Industry - Good for the Country

  • Hits: 4

Eucalyptus, not native to Brazil, was imported from Australia in the early 20th century and it loves the earth of Minas Gerais. Strong as Oak, versatile as Pine, it grows to amazing heights within a short time, producing flowers pollinated by bees who make very good honey, bark and leaves for medicine, sturdy wood used for residential, agricultural and commercial construction and infrastructure, and recycled biomass waste for heat and power.
